## Summary of CMDB classes targeted in Service Graph Connector for Microsoft Azure

The Service Graph Connector for Microsoft Azure enables ServiceNow customers to integrate and periodically pull configuration data from Microsoft Azure into their Configuration Management Database (CMDB).
This integration populates multiple CMDB tables that extend from the core Configuration Item \[cmdbci\] table, representing Azure resources and their relationships.
Show full answer Show less  

## Key Features

* **Populates CMDB Classes:** The connector collects and maps data into numerous CMDB classes such as Application, Availability Zone, Azure Datacenter, Cloud Database, Cloud Function, Cloud Load Balancer, Cloud Network, Cloud Public IP Address, Cloud Resource, Cloud Service Account, Cloud Storage Account, Cloud Subnet, Cloud WebServer, Compute Security Group, Computer, Hardware Type, Image, Instance Scale Set, IP Address, Kubernetes Cluster, Linux Server, Resource Group, Serial Number, Server, Software, Storage Volume, Virtual Machine Instance, and Windows Server.
* **Attribute Mapping:** Each class has specific attributes populated from Azure data, including identifiers (like Object ID), names, operational status, versions, IP addresses, and other relevant details essential for accurate configuration item representation.
* **Defined Relationships:** The connector establishes explicit parent-child and hosting relationships between classes. For example, Virtual Machine Instances are hosted on Azure Datacenters, Applications run on Computers, and Cloud Load Balancers own Cloud LB IP Addresses. These relationships reflect the real-world dependencies among Azure resources.
* **Cloud Hardware Type Configuration:** Administrators can enable a cloud-specific hardware type class extension to better reflect cloud data center hardware by setting a system property, improving hardware representation in the CMDB.

When you complete setting up the connection, you can configure the integration to periodically
pull data from Microsoft Azure. The data is saved in tables that extend from the
Configuration item \[cmdb_ci\] table.

## Application \[cmdb_ci_appl\] {#cmdb-azure-classes__section_mtg_rdb_hdc}

The following attributes in the Application \[cmdb_ci_appl\] table are populated by collected data:{#cmdb-azure-classes__table_trd_gss_1gc__entry__2}

| Attribute label | Attribute name |
|-|-|
| Class | sys_class_name |
| Version | version |
| TCP port(s) | tcp_port |
| Running Process | running_process |
| Running process key parameters | running_process_key_parameters |
| Name | name |
| Running process command | running_process_command |
[ ]

{#cmdb-azure-classes__table_trd_gss_1gc}{#cmdb-azure-classes__table_gtk_gss_1gc__entry__3}

| Parent class | Relationship type | Child class |
|-|-|-|
| Application \[cmdb_ci_appl\] | Runs on::Runs | Computer \[cmdb_ci_computer\] |
[Table 1. Relationship created for Application]

{#cmdb-azure-classes__table_gtk_gss_1gc}

## Azure Datacenter \[cmdb_ci_azure_datacenter\] {#cmdb-azure-classes__section_qhy_tp5_vxb}

The following attributes in the Azure Datacenter \[cmdb_ci_azure_datacenter\] table are populated by collected data.{#cmdb-azure-classes__table_lmk_f1l_gvb__entry__2}

| Attribute label | Attribute name |
|-|-|
| Comments | comments |
| Name | name |
| Object ID | object_id |
| Region | region |
| Status | install_status |
[ ]

{#cmdb-azure-classes__table_lmk_f1l_gvb}{#cmdb-azure-classes__table_lsk_31l_gvb__entry__3}

| Parent class | Relationship type | Child class |
|-|-|-|
| Azure Datacenter \[cmdb_ci_azure_datacenter\] | Hosted on::Hosts | Cloud Service Account \[cmdb_ci_cloud_service_account\] |
| Azure Datacenter \[cmdb_ci_azure_datacenter\] | Contains::Contained by | Resource Group \[cmdb_ci_resource_group\] |
| Azure Datacenter \[cmdb_ci_azure_datacenter\] | Contains::Contained by | Availability Zone \[cmdb_ci_availability_zone\] |
[Table 3. Relationships created for Azure Datacenter]

{#cmdb-azure-classes__table_lsk_31l_gvb}

## Hardware Type \[cmdb_ci_compute_template\] {#cmdb-azure-classes__section_nkn_qp5_vxb}

The following attributes in the Hardware Type \[cmdb_ci_compute_template\] table are populated by collected data. {#cmdb-azure-classes__table_sby_rzk_gvb__entry__2}

| Attribute label | Attribute name |
|-|-|
| Name | name |
| Object ID | object_id |
| Class | sys_class_name |
| Cores | cores |
| Logical Storage GB | local_storage_gb |
| Memory MB | memory_mb |
| vCPUs | vcpus |
[ ]

{#cmdb-azure-classes__table_sby_rzk_gvb}{#cmdb-azure-classes__table_u23_xz2_bgc__entry__3}

| Parent class | Relationship type | Child class |
|-|-|-|
| Hardware Type \[cmdb_ci_compute_template\] | Hosted on::Hosts | Azure Datacenter \[cmdb_ci_azure_datacenter\] |
[Table 17. Relationship created for Hardware Type]

{#cmdb-azure-classes__table_u23_xz2_bgc}  
Note:  
When the Cloud Hardware Type class extension is enabled, the Class attribute is set to `Cloud Hardware Type`. Else, the attribute is set to `Hardware
Type`.

As a user with the admin role, you can enable the Cloud Hardware Type class extension by setting the use a single hardware type for cloud data centers property
(sn_itom_pattern.use a single hardware type for cloud data centers) to `true`. For more information, see the [Service Graph Connector For Microsoft Azure - Migrating to a new hardware type model \[KB1288455\]](https://support.servicenow.com/kb_view.do?sysparm_article=KB1288455) article in the Now Support Knowledge Base.

## Virtual Machine Instance \[cmdb_ci_vm_instance\] {#cmdb-azure-classes__section_ml4_bq5_vxb}

The following attributes in the Virtual Machine Instance \[cmdb_ci_vm_instance\] table are populated by collected data.{#cmdb-azure-classes__table_whf_qcl_gvb__entry__2}

| Attribute label | Attribute name |
|-|-|
| CPUs | cpus |
| Disks size (GB) | disks_size |
| Install Status | install_status |
| IP Address | ip_address |
| Memory (MB) | memory |
| Name | name |
| Object ID | object_id |
| Operational status | operational_status |
| State | state |
| VM Instance ID | vm_inst_id |
[ ]

{#cmdb-azure-classes__table_whf_qcl_gvb}{#cmdb-azure-classes__table_ljf_tcl_gvb__entry__3}

| Parent class | Relationship type | Child class |
|-|-|-|
| Virtual Machine Instance \[cmdb_ci_vm_instance\] | Managed by::Manages | Instance Scale Set \[cmdb_ci_instance_scale_set\] |
| Virtual Machine Instance \[cmdb_ci_vm_instance\] | Hosted on::Hosts | Azure Datacenter \[cmdb_ci_azure_datacenter\] |
| Virtual Machine Instance \[cmdb_ci_vm_instance\] | Provisioned From::Provisioned | Image \[cmdb_ci_os_template\] |
| Virtual Machine Instance \[cmdb_ci_vm_instance\] | Provisioned From::Provisioned | Hardware Type \[cmdb_ci_compute_template\] |
| Virtual Machine Instance \[cmdb_ci_vm_instance\] | Contains::Contained by | Cloud Mgmt Network Interface \[cmdb_ci_nic\] |
| Virtual Machine Instance \[cmdb_ci_vm_instance\] | Uses:Used by | Storage Volume \[cmdb_ci_storage_volume\] |
| Virtual Machine Instance \[cmdb_ci_vm_instance\] | Reference | Key Value \[cmdb_key_value\] |
| Virtual Machine Instance \[cmdb_ci_vm_instance\] | Reference | Computer \[cmdb_ci_computer\] |
[Table 30. Relationships created for Virtual Machine Instance]

{#cmdb-azure-classes__table_ljf_tcl_gvb}
